Handover: Exportron retry queue

Hi Mira — handing over the failed-export retries. Exports that hit a timeout land in the retry queue and get three attempts with backoff; after that they're parked and need a manual requeue from the admin panel. Watch for customers reporting duplicates — that usually means a double requeue. The current retry settings are as follows.

settings of bajog-fawig:
oliael:
  log_level: warn
  metrics_host: metrics.oliael.zemvarsys.internal
  pin: 0267
  pool_size: 32

# Break-Glass: Catalog Cache Invalidation

Scope: the Pinrow product catalog at Veldstone Retail. If stale prices persist after a purge and the Hollowmere invalidation queue is wedged, use break-glass to flush the edge tier directly. Contractors: get verbal sign-off from the catalog lead first. Steps: open the Hollowmere admin shell, select emergency-flush, confirm the tenant, and run it once — repeated flushes thrash the origin. Access is logged and expires after 20 minutes. Unseal the admin shell with the passphrase below.

recovery phrase for kahop-tajog: istix-casvan

# Hey, new folks — read this before touching migrations.
#
# Fernhollow deploys schema changes in expand/contract phases so the app
# never sees a missing column. Always ship the expand migration a full
# release before the contract one, and let Marisol's checker lint it
# first. The migration runner needs write access to the primary, which
# it gets from the credential set right here:

sealed setting: LEDGER_TOKEN5=bcca1